Tabango, officially the Municipality of Tabango, is a municipality in the province of Leyte, Philippines. According to the 2020 census, it has a population of 33,868 people. Tabango is situated 6 km southeast of Santa Rosa.

San Isidro, officially the Municipality of San Isidro, is a municipality in the province of Leyte, Philippines. According to the 2020 census, it has a population of 30,722 people. San Isidro is situated 6 km north of Santa Rosa.
